Landsat subpixel water cover of Lena River Delta, Siberia, with link to ESRI grid files
Landsat data for Samoylov Island (Lena Delta, Siberia) was classified using a k-means unsupervised algorithm in the ENVI 4.7 software. Unsupervised classifications are based solely on the natural groupings within the image, i.e. the spectral properties of the surface, and as such return classes containing spectrally similar pixels. The resulting satellite spectral classification was compared with the aerial land cover classification in order to assess the fine-scale land cover variability within each satellite pixel and k-means class. Classification of was performed with 15 clusters and 15 iterations. The 15 clusters were reduced to 9 groups by merging clusters with little pixel count into spectrally adjacent classes. k-means classification of Landsat pixels is determined by the proportions of open water and dry tundra within each pixel. Class 1 is a water class. Classes 2-9 are characterized by a gradual decrease in open water and an increase in dry tundra.
The entire Lena Delta was then classified using an atmospherically corrected Landsat mosaic (Schneider et al., 2009, doi:10.1016/j.rse.2008.10.013). Schneider et al. (2009) identified nine land cover classes for the Lena Delta, five of which are present in the ice-wedge polygonal tundra on Samoylov Island. We therefore performed classification for these five classes only, which together make up 70% of the total land area in the Lena Delta. The Landsat mosaic consists of three images with a resolution of 30 m, acquired on July 27, 2000 (featuring Samoylov Island), and July 26, 2001. Bands 1-5 and band 7 were used for classification covering a spectral range in the VNIR and short-wave infrared (SWIR) from 450 to 2350 nm.
Some 13% of the delta's land surface (not including rivers and coastal areas) has been estimated from Landsat data to be occupied by water bodies (Schneider et al. 2009). Including the subpixel-scale land/water fraction, the water surface area increases to 20%.
Data is available as raster (ESRI bil). Data includes an ArcGIS layer file showing the mean ratio of open water per pixel and class. Class 10 (Lena river and coastal zones) was not included in the original classification of the Delta, but was added to the dataset for better visual aid.

Interpretation and performance of three orchestral compositions by Gabriela Lena Frank: Escaramuza, Elegia Andian, and Three Latin American Dances
This work presents interpretative and performance suggestions for three of Gabriela Lena Frank’s orchestral works: Escaramuza (2010), Elegia Andina (2000), and Three Latin American Dances (2004). Frank’s compositions frequently include programmatic elements that reference other well-known compositions, and she incorporates melodies, rhythms, timbres, instrumentation, and performance techniques characteristic of her Peruvian cultural heritage. Examples of these elements are presented from a lecture recital format to demonstrate how performance practice and conducting decisions—in rehearsal and performance—can be utilized to honor the composer’s expressed intent and overcome various technical ensemble and conducting challenges. An overview of the cultural contextual elements includes Harawi and Kachampa dance structures. The author also suggests methods for presenting elements that affect the timbre and instrumental scoring specific to each work, for example the Andean Zampoña. Methane production and storage in the Lena river delta during winter 2011
Measured methane concentrations in the ice cover of ponds and lakes on Samoylov Island (Lena-River-Delta in northern Siberia). Methane concentration were extracted from ice core samples. The location of each sample relative to the lake surface is indicated by a minimum and maximum depth. The ice cores were extracted by cutting ice columns to a depth of about 70 cm from the ice cover. The ice samples were melted in 1 L plastic containers. Methan concentration were obtained by head-space analysis. For a detailed description of the methods see Langer et al. (2015)

(Table 2) In situ measured ice thickness, snow depth and water depth in April 2015 at 14 locations on 10 lakes in the Lena River Delta, Siberia
In situ ice thickness measurements were performed with powered hole borer at 14 locations from a sample of 10 lakes in April 2015 in the Lena River Delta, Siberia. Seven of these locations featured grounded ice and the other seven floating ice. Additionally, snow depth on the ice surface and water depth beneath the ice cover (if present) were measured
